Nollywood actress Moyo Lawal recently caught attention after sharing a gym mishap that resulted in a cut on her lip.
In a video posted on her Instagram, she showed her injury and talked about her feelings. Moyo had previously made news for being emotional about feeling lonely when Bobrisky was not around.
Now, she expressed her annoyance about the accident and mentioned that she might stop exercising.
In the video, Moyo Lawal said:
“I injured myself. I hate this gym, I am not working out again.”
